FDA Clearance Information

Pathway 510K
Decision Date December 19, 2003
Product Code DQX
Device Class Class 2
Evidence 419 studies

The hydrophilic guidewire was cleared by the FDA via the 510(k) pathway on December 19, 2003. It is manufactured by Lake Region Mfg. and classified as a Class 2 medical device.

What It Is

The hydrophilic guidewire is a medical device designed to facilitate the navigation of vascular pathways during minimally invasive procedures. Its hydrophilic coating reduces friction, allowing for smoother passage through blood vessels.

Clinical Applications

Commonly used in procedures such as neuroendovascular therapy, uterine artery embolization, and transradial coronary angiography, the hydrophilic guidewire assists in the precise placement of catheters and other devices.

Safety Profile

Reported complications include polymer coating embolism during neuroendovascular therapy, which can lead to serious complications. Other studies highlight the potential for passage difficulty and branch injury during transradial procedures.

Evidence Limitations

The evidence is limited by the small size of some studies and the lack of large-scale randomized controlled trials. Further research is needed to fully understand the mechanisms of polymer fragment formation and to optimize safety protocols.
